I deeply regret I haven’t seen this gorgeous Elle Embellished Pumps not earlier. What a beauties! A white pump with a black nose and a mixed chain around the ankles. The towering 4.5 inch (11 cm) stiletto heel is a bit compensated with a 1 inch (2,5 cm) hidden platform.
There is also a black variant which is also very nice, but not as nice as the white one. It’s the two-tone that makes the difference. Looking through the reviews it’s a very popular shoe in high demand. At the moment the shoe is not in stock unfortunately.
Take a pair of classic black or white pumps and turn it into art. That’s what Detroit-based artist Courtney Mason from Studio Jellyfish must have thought when she started painting heels. For Mason heels are the perfect canvas for representation of a women’s style and individuality. And she is right of course! With this piece of art it really brings some individuality to the shoe. The painted shoes are available for $129 at Etsy in all sizes.

I have already talked before about thigh high boots getting trendy. Also Emilio Pucci has thigh high boots in the collection. However, he did something different. He made the leather boot white (creme). You might not think that’s very special. But look around, all thigh high boots you see are black, brown or red. You might find a plastic white $45 hooker pair, including a 4 inch platform and 8 inch high heel. I think you have to agree with me this boot is something completely different. However, I’m not sure if white is a very practical color during the winter.
